Abstract
The invention discloses a kind of convenient conveyer of bearing-type, including frame, frame lower section is provided with elevating mechanism, and frame top is provided with induction system, and frame side is provided with motor housing, motor is provided with motor housing.Elevating mechanism is hydraulic pressure or pressure liftable platform.Induction system includes some groups of conveying mechanisms arranged in parallel, and every group of conveying mechanism includes two the first conveying axis and second conveying axis.The outside of each the first conveying axis is socketed with sprocket wheel, and matching has chain guard on sprocket wheel, and the inner side of each the first conveying axis is socketed with the first roller.The second roller is socketed with second conveying axis.Two pieces of steel structure platforms are filled with frame between two the first conveying axis and the second conveying axis.The design of bearing-type of the present invention, directly walks on a conveyor beneficial to fork truck, and manpower intervention is convenient, greatly improves efficiency, and safety in production, liftable design meets the demand of different places, facilitates manual adjustment to produce, and can meet various working demand.

Technical field
The present invention relates to automation logistic warehousing and storaging field, more particularly to a kind of convenient conveyer of bearing-type.
Background technology
Conveyer is a kind of machinery of continuous transport goods, in automatic stereowarehouse, goes out to be put in storage induction system conduct
The key equipment that tiered warehouse facility memory block joins with extraneous (going out storage station).The quality of its design will directly influence whole vertical
The reasonability of body warehouse system and the smoothness of cargo movement.With the development of industry, prior art many times can not meet
The requirement of client, and enterprise increasingly paid close attention to production safety.Goods gets lodged in conveying when existing in actual motion into outbound
Situation on machine, often leads to a storehouse or a tunnel this when and stops production.Manpower intervention is now needed, is leveraged
Efficiency.
The content of the invention
Goal of the invention:The invention aims to solve deficiency of the prior art, there is provided a kind of manpower intervention is convenient,
Operating efficiency is improve, is kept the safety in production, the use of different places can be met, the convenient conveying of bearing-type for facilitating manual adjustment to produce
Machine.
Technical scheme:The convenient conveyer of a kind of bearing-type of the invention, including frame, frame lower section are provided with elevating mechanism,
Frame top is provided with induction system, and frame side is provided with motor housing, motor is provided with motor housing;
Induction system includes some groups of conveying mechanisms arranged in parallel, every group of conveying mechanism include two the first conveying axis and
One the second conveying axis, respectively positioned at the both sides of frame, the second conveying axis are located at two the first conveying axis to two the first conveying axis
Between;
The outside of each the first conveying axis is socketed with sprocket wheel, on sprocket wheel matching have chain guard, each the first conveying axis it is interior
Side is socketed with the first roller;The second roller is socketed with second conveying axis, the second roller is highly identical with the first roller;
First conveying axis and the second conveying axis are connected with motor, the first conveying axis and the second conveying axis synchronous axial system;
Platform is filled with frame between two the first conveying axis and the second conveying axis.
Further, the height of platform is less than the first roller.
Further, the quantity of platform is two, and platform is steel structure platform.
Further, it is equipped with conveying pallet on the first roller and the second roller.
Further, it is interval with spacing ring on the first roller of each conveying mechanism.
Further, the spacing between every two adjacent groups conveying mechanism center is 132mm-138mm.
Further, the external diameter of the first roller and the second roller is 87mm-92mm.
Further, the width of platform is 200mm-250mm.
Further, elevating mechanism is hydraulic pressure or pressure liftable platform.
Beneficial effect:
Design point of the invention is that Log conveyor is only a conveyor surface, either roll-type or chain type, this
Invention has added two steel structure platforms on original conveyor surface, facilitates fork truck to be walked above, runs into the accumulation of conveyer goods
Situation, manually or mechanical forklift gets on picking can substantially increase efficiency.And when manpower intervention be in steel knot
Walked on structure platform, can greatly protect the safety of operator, reduced due to the caused meanings such as landing of walking on a conveyor
Outer accident.The design of hoistable platform in elevating mechanism so that the scope that conveyer is used is wider, adaptable place is more.
Height can be directly adjusted when running into shelf height, production efficiency is greatly improved, rapid and convenient facilitates field adjustable.Meet
Height can also be adjusted when accumulation to goods and facilitates manpower intervention picking, convenient efficiency high, scheme is various.As for lift
Optional, the hydraulic pressure that is designed with kinds of schemes of structure, air pressure manually etc. can be according to the difference of field requirement or customer demand
Difference formulates different schemes.Same induction system is also in this way, according to different demands, selecting chain type or roll-type.This
The design of invention bearing-type, directly walks on a conveyor beneficial to fork truck, manpower intervention it is convenient, greatly improve efficiency,
Safety in production, liftable design, easy to use and flexible meets different operating height, the use demand of different places, facilitates people
Work regulation production, induction system structure type is various, can meet various working demand.
